HB 397
AN ACT relating to trophy catfish.

Bill overview
Create a new section of KRS Chapter 150 to define terms; require that any permit issued to take a lower Ohio River trophy catfish shall expire on May 31, 2027; prohibit the issuance or reissuance of an any lower Ohio River trophy catfish permits after that date; after the effective date of the Act, prohibit the transfer or reissuance of any lower Ohio River trophy catfish permit; prohibit the transportation of live trophy catfish except by boat while in the course of legally fishing; amend KRS 150.990 to make a violation of the prohibition on transporting live trophy catfish a Class A misdemeanor for the first offense and a Class D felony for each subsequent offense.
